在当今的数据处理和机器学习领域,“印刷体数字识别”已经成为许多行业的核心需求之一。利用 Python 实现的数字识别技术,不仅可以用于银行票据的自动化处理、文档数字化以及图书馆系统的数据管理,还可以广泛应用于报表分析等场景。本文将通过以下几个部分详细探讨如何使用 Python 进行印刷体数字识别的整体过程,包含背景定位、演进历程、架构设计、性能攻坚、复盘总结和扩展应用。
## 背景定位
在各行
一、实验目的 初步了解模板匹配算法,理解bmp 图像在内存中的存储形式,实现bmp 格式图像印刷体数字的识别。 二、算法概要 由于实验要求是对标准印刷体数字进行识别,本实验采用模板匹配中最简单的像素点重合的方法,将待测图像中的数字与模板库中的各个数字进行比对,认为待测数字就是模板库中与其重合像素点最多的数字。 当bmp 图像读入
转载
2024-07-22 15:52:50
35阅读
数字识别和其他的所有计算机视觉相关的应用都会分为两个步骤:ROI抽取和识别。 1. ROI抽取即将感兴趣的区域从原始图像中分离初来,这个步骤包括二值化,噪点的消除等2. 识别即
原创
2023-06-06 11:37:12
356阅读
# Python 识别印刷体的实现流程
## 1. 概述
在本文中,我将向你介绍使用 Python 实现印刷体识别的步骤和代码。印刷体识别是一项非常有用的技术,在许多应用领域都有广泛的应用,比如自动化数据输入、图像处理等。通过本文的学习,你将了解到如何使用 Python 识别印刷体,并能够为自己的项目中添加这一功能。
## 2. 实现步骤
下表是实现印刷体识别的步骤概述:
| 步骤 |
原创
2023-09-16 06:52:33
326阅读
1. 下载并导入torchvision导入torchvision的时候尝试了很多方法,都没有成功,之前一直下载了好多东西,直到最后手动地在pythond对应的解释路径添加完包后,运行才没有报错,下面就把具体的步骤写下来:首先下载并安装torchvision: 参考这篇博客因为下载了很多次,集体是不是这次下载成功的也不清楚,但是我记得使用这条语句后是显示成功了的之后发现在Pycharm里import
转载
2024-09-09 15:43:16
26阅读
目录1、基本原理1.1 小波变换的基本原理1.2 图像置乱技术2、水印的嵌入与提取具体实施步骤2.1 水印嵌入算法2.2 水印攻击算法2.3 水印提取算法3、算法性能评估3.1 鲁棒性测试3.2 不可见性测试1、基本原理 本文实现的DWT水印嵌入及提取算法主要包含三部分程序:水印的嵌入、水印的提取、水印图像的攻击
转载
2024-02-02 10:47:27
110阅读
以复用试卷的场景为例,想给学生布置试卷,但只有学生做过的版本,怎么办?只能手动擦除笔迹或者手抄错题,那未免太“费人”了。一旦遇到无法擦除的笔记,则只能选择重新打印试卷。这类试卷复用难、打印成本高的问题每天都在上演,教学效率难以提升。TextIn支持多个现实场景下,纸张上手写文字的快速识别和自动擦除,并可对噪点、阴影、背景杂乱等复杂场景进行智能处理,将文档图像恢复至手写前的状态。这个功能可以大幅节约
目录1、数据准备2、训练集和测试集划分3、SVM模型训练3.1 数据准备3.2 特征选取3.3 配置SVM训练器参数3.4 保存模型4、加载模型实现分类 1、数据准备在OpenCV的安装路径下,搜索digits.png,可以得到一张图片,图片大小为1000* 2000,有0-9的10个数字,每5行为一个数字,总共50行,共有5000个手写数字,每个数字块大小为20* 20。 如下图所示: 下面将
转载
2024-10-12 11:00:53
300阅读
一、准备工作 1、创建云函数identify 2、云函数identify中index.js代码 1 // 云函数入口文件 2 const cloud = require('wx-server-sdk') 3 4 //cloud.init() 5 //环境变量初始化 6 cloud.init({ 7 ...
转载
2021-07-26 11:03:00
72阅读
2评论
# 印刷数字识别与Python3
## 概述
印刷数字识别是计算机视觉领域的一个重要任务。它旨在通过计算机程序将印刷体的数字转化为可识别的数字形式。这项技术在许多领域都有广泛的应用,包括自动化识别、邮政编码、自动化财务等。在本文中,我们将介绍如何使用Python3来实现印刷数字识别,并提供相应的代码示例。
## 项目概述
我们将使用一个基于深度学习的印刷数字识别项目作为例子,该项目使用了M
原创
2023-10-20 18:33:40
164阅读
为了成批地给图像增加水印,我们这里用到了枕头模块。它的英文名为pillow。安装它的方式为用cmd命令打开DOS提示符窗口,然后输入pip install pillow即可。就像下面这样:python如何安装pillow模块安装好了pillow模块后,就能使用里面的类或者子模块等了。为了能给图片增加水印,我们需要导入 Image类 、ImageFont类、ImageDraw类、ImageSeque
转载
2024-07-20 20:33:27
70阅读
mnist = input_data.read_data_sets("MNIST_data",one_hot=True)OneHot编码:One-Hot编码,又称为一位有效编码,主要是采用N位状态寄存器来对N个状态进行编码,每个状态都由他独立的寄存器位,并且在任意时候只有一位有效。将类别变量转换为机器学习算法易于利用的一种形式的过程。One-Hot编码是分类变量作为二进制向量的表示。这首先要求将分
转载
2024-01-08 20:41:00
77阅读
一、文字识别概述汉字是历史悠久的中华民族文化的重要结晶,闪烁着中国人民智慧的光芒。汉字数量众多,仅清朝编纂的《康熙字典》就包含了49,000多个汉字,其数量之大,构思之精,为世界文明史所仅有。由于汉字为非字母化、非拼音化的文字,所以在信息技术及计算机技术日益普及的今天,如何将汉字方便、快速地输入到计算机中已成为关系到计算机技术能否在我国真正普及的关键问题。前文图1所示将汉字输入到计算机里一般有两种
一、OCR简介OCR技术是光学字符识别的缩写, 是通过扫描等光学输入方式将各种票据、报刊、书籍、文稿及其它印刷品的文字转化为图像信息, 再利用文字识别技术将图像信息转化为可以使用的计算机输入技术。由于其应用前景广泛, 在应用领域有着重要的意义。1 预处理部分本部分可进一步细分为要素定位、二值化、切割、文字归整几个部分。由清分机或者高速扫描仪扫入的原始票据经过本部分的处理, 其识别要素如金额、日期按照单个汉字分别被存储为汉字点阵, 其中手写体大写汉字、印刷体大写汉字以及印刷体小写数字, 被存储为6464
原创
2022-01-15 13:51:15
260阅读
1评论
一、OCR简介OCR技术是光学字符识别的缩写, 是通过扫描等光学输入方式将各种票据、报刊、书籍、文稿及其它印刷品的文字转化为图像信息, 再利用文字识别技术将图像信息转化为可以使用的计算机输入技术。
原创
2022-01-19 15:25:55
191阅读
1 内容介绍图像配准是指同一目标的两幅(或者是多幅)图像在空间位置上的对齐.图像配准技术过程称为图像匹配或者图像相关,是数字图像处理和机器视觉中比较基础且核心的技术分支,也是立体视觉,图像融合,动态视频检测等应用的基础.在医学影像,遥感领域,军事导航,地理信息系统,目标识别,航空航天技术,虚拟现实及人工智能等领域已经得到广泛应用.随着应用技术的复杂化,对图像配准算法的实时性,精确性,适应性,高效性
原创
2022-08-24 09:53:11
1048阅读
OCR技术是光学字符识别的缩写, 是通过扫描等光学输入方
原创
2022-06-07 17:07:23
580阅读
2 算法设计流程银行卡卡号识别技术原理是先对银行卡图像定位,保障获取图像绝对位置后,对图像进行字符分割,然后将分割完成的信息与模型进行比较,从而匹配出与其最相似的数字。主要流程图如图1.银行卡号图像 由于银行卡卡号信息涉及个人隐私,作者很难在短时间内获取大量的银行卡进行测试和试验,本文即采用作者个人及模拟银行卡进行卡号识别测试。2.图像预处理 图像预处理是在获取图像后必须优先进行的技术性处理工作,
1 简介OCR技术是光学字符识别的缩写, 是通过扫描等光学输入方式将各种票据、报刊、书籍、文稿及其它印刷品的文字转化为图像信息, 再利用文字识别技术将图像信息转化为可以使用的计算机输入技术。由于其应用前景广泛, 在应用领域有着重要的意义。1 预处理部分本部分可进一步细分为要素定位、二值化、切割、文字归整几个部分。由清分机或者高速扫描仪扫入的原始票据经过本部分的处理, 其识别要素如金额、日期按照单个
原创
2022-02-09 10:25:04
405阅读
# Python 如何识别Logo的印刷不良问题
在现代制造业中,印刷质量直接影响品牌形象与市场竞争力。随着自动化与智能化的推进,利用Python等编程语言来自动识别Logo的印刷不良问题显得尤为重要。本文将介绍一种基于图像处理的方法,以识别Logo在印刷过程中的常见缺陷。
## 问题描述
在印刷过程中,Logo可能会出现多种缺陷,例如颜色不均、模糊、斑点等。我们需要一种能够自动检测这些问题